Ingredients
- For the Dough:
- 5 ⅔ cups all-purpose flour (700 grams)
- 2 ½ tablespoons instant yeast (30 grams)
- 2 teaspoons kosher salt (10 grams)
- ¼ cup ground flax (20 grams)
- ¼ cup sugar (50 grams)
- ¼ cup coconut oil (50 grams), melted
- 1 ¾ cups water (415 grams)
- 1 tablespoon vanilla extract (15 grams)
- For the Glaze:
- Hibiscus (for red color)
- Mango and turmeric (for orange color)
- Matcha (for green color)
- Blue magik and vanilla (for blue color)
- Lavender and ube (for purple color)
- ½ cup coconut milk (120 milliliters)
- 5 cups confectioners sugar (600 grams)
Directions
- Dough Preparation:
- In a stand mixer, mix all dry ingredients (flour, yeast, salt, ground flax, and sugar).
- In a separate bowl, combine the melted coconut oil, water, and vanilla extract.
- With the mixer running at low speed (speed 1), gradually add the liquid mixture to the dry ingredients until a dough forms. Continue to knead until smooth and elastic.
- Shaping and Baking:
- Once the dough is ready, turn it out onto a floured surface, divide, and shape into donuts.
- Let the donuts proof until doubled in size, then fry in hot oil until golden brown on both sides.
- Preparing the Glaze:
- For each color, prepare a separate glaze by infusing coconut milk with the natural color sources listed, then strain.
- Whisk in confectioners sugar to create a smooth glaze.
- Glazing the Donuts:
- Once the donuts are cooled, dip them into the different glazes to create a vibrant display.

FAQs
- Can I bake these donuts instead of frying?
- Yes, for a healthier option, you can bake them at 375°F (190°C) for about 15 minutes or until golden.
- How do I store leftover donuts?
- Keep them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days, or refrigerate for longer storage.
- What are Blue magik and ube?
- Blue magik is derived from spirulina, offering a vibrant blue hue, while ube is a type of purple yam commonly used in Filipino desserts for its color and flavor.
